Kulsoom Niaz Opposes Anti-Terrorism Amendment Bill, Calls It a Violation of Human Rights

Quetta: National Party’s Provincial Women Secretary and Member of the Balochistan Assembly, Kulsoom Niaz Baloch, strongly opposed the Anti-Terrorism Amendment Bill during the assembly session, labeling it a violation of fundamental human rights. When she attempted to express her views on the bill, the Speaker denied her the opportunity to speak, prompting her to walk out of the assembly in protest.
Notably, Kulsoom Niaz was the only member from the National Party present at the session, and no other opposition member joined her in the walkout. Speaking to the media after the session, she voiced serious reservations about the bill, warning that it could become a tool for suppressing civil liberties and may lead to an increase in enforced disappearances and human rights violations in Balochistan.
She stated that such laws do not establish peace but instead create unrest and distrust among the public.
